Routledge Performance Practitioners is a series of introductory guides to the key theatre-makers of the last century. Each volume explains the background to and the work of one of the major influences on twentieth- and twenty-first-century performance. These compact, well-illustrated, and clearly written books will unravel the contribution of modern theatre’s most charismatic innovators.

This newly-updated volume draws on unprecedented access to Pina Bausch's work to provide a beautifully written and illustrated guide to her dance theatre. This significantly revised second edition explores Pina Bausch’s work and methods by combining interviews, first-hand accounts, and practical exercises from her method for students of both dance and theatre. As the first English language overview of her work, this book offers new and exciting insight into the theatrical approach of a unique theatre practitioner.

This is an essential introduction to the life and work of one of the most significant choreographers/directors of the twentieth and twenty-first centuries. As a first step towards critical understanding, and as an initial exploration before going on to further, primary research, Routledge Performance Practitioners are unbeatable value for today’s student.
